A New Era of Design Philosophy

Gone are the days when automotive design was solely driven by raw power or flashy visuals. Modern designers are prioritizing subtlety, balance, and user-centered innovation. Sleek lines, minimalist interiors, and aerodynamic profiles are more than stylistic choices; they’re strategic decisions that enhance efficiency, safety, and comfort. Vehicles are becoming an extension of the driver, responding intuitively to needs while reducing environmental impact. This shift in philosophy highlights that modern power is often silent, efficient, and refined, rather than loud and aggressive.

Technology as a Silent Partner

Modern automotive design thrives on the integration of technology that feels invisible yet transformative. Advanced driver-assistance systems, adaptive cruise control, and AI-enhanced navigation work quietly behind the scenes, creating safer, smoother, and more personalized journeys. Infotainment systems are sleekly integrated, offering intuitive interfaces without overwhelming the driver. The quiet power of technology doesn’t call attention to itself, but it amplifies the driving experience while minimizing distractions, reflecting a philosophy that less can indeed be more.

Crafting an Experience, Not Just a Vehicle

Design today focuses on creating experiences rather than just manufacturing vehicles. Every curve, button, and material choice contributes to a cohesive sensory experience. Interiors are designed with tactile satisfaction in mind: soft-touch materials, ambient lighting, and ergonomic layouts transform commutes into moments of comfort and calm. The exterior, meanwhile, communicates personality and presence without needing aggressive styling. This holistic approach ensures that driving is not only efficient and safe but also emotionally engaging.
